.elementor-3039 .elementor-element.elementor-element-32abc935{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:8%;--padding-bottom:8%;--padding-left:5%;--padding-right:5%;}.elementor-3039 .elementor-element.elementor-element-1ffa42ab{--display:flex;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--align-items:flex-start;--gap:1.6em 1.6em;--row-gap:1.6em;--column-gap:1.6em;}.elementor-3039 .elementor-element.elementor-element-fd429f3{text-align:start;}.elementor-3039 .elementor-element.elementor-element-fd429f3 .elementor-heading-title{font-family:var( --e-global-typography-a20d4d8-font-family ), Sans-serif;font-size:var( --e-global-typography-a20d4d8-font-size );font-weight:var( --e-global-typography-a20d4d8-font-weight );line-height:var( --e-global-typography-a20d4d8-line-height );}.elementor-3039 .elementor-element.elementor-element-7e58dc19{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--align-items:center;--gap:2% 2%;--row-gap:2%;--column-gap:2%;--flex-wrap:nowrap;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-3039 .elementor-element.elementor-element-d50a671 .elementor-icon-wrapper{text-align:center;}.elementor-3039 .elementor-element.elementor-element-d50a671.elementor-view-stacked .elementor-icon{background-color:var( --e-global-color-secondary );}.elementor-3039 .elementor-element.elementor-element-d50a671.elementor-view-framed .elementor-icon, .elementor-3039 .elementor-element.elementor-element-d50a671.elementor-view-default .elementor-icon{color:var( --e-global-color-secondary );border-color:var( --e-global-color-secondary );}.elementor-3039 .elementor-element.elementor-element-d50a671.elementor-view-framed .elementor-icon, .elementor-3039 .elementor-element.elementor-element-d50a671.elementor-view-default .elementor-icon svg{fill:var( --e-global-color-secondary );}.elementor-3039 .elementor-element.elementor-element-d50a671 .elementor-icon{font-size:1.4em;}.elementor-3039 .elementor-element.elementor-element-d50a671 .elementor-icon svg{height:1.4em;}.elementor-3039 .elementor-element.elementor-element-4d653a3{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;}.elementor-3039 .elementor-element.elementor-element-656296c .elementor-heading-title{font-family:var( --e-global-typography-408b3ee-font-family ), Sans-serif;font-size:var( --e-global-typography-408b3ee-font-size );font-weight:var( --e-global-typography-408b3ee-font-weight );text-transform:var( --e-global-typography-408b3ee-text-transform );letter-spacing:var( --e-global-typography-408b3ee-letter-spacing );}.elementor-3039 .elementor-element.elementor-element-341b7a1 .elementor-heading-title{font-family:var( --e-global-typography-408b3ee-font-family ), Sans-serif;font-size:var( --e-global-typography-408b3ee-font-size );font-weight:var( --e-global-typography-408b3ee-font-weight );text-transform:var( --e-global-typography-408b3ee-text-transform );letter-spacing:var( --e-global-typography-408b3ee-letter-spacing );}.elementor-3039 .elementor-element.elementor-element-deae66e{--divider-border-style:solid;--divider-color:var( --e-global-color-accent );--divider-border-width:4px;}.elementor-3039 .elementor-element.elementor-element-deae66e .elementor-divider-separator{width:100%;}.elementor-3039 .elementor-element.elementor-element-deae66e .elementor-divider{padding-block-start:16px;padding-block-end:16px;}@media(max-width:1366px){.elementor-3039 .elementor-element.elementor-element-32abc935{--padding-top:10%;--padding-bottom:10%;--padding-left:5%;--padding-right:5%;}.elementor-3039 .elementor-element.elementor-element-fd429f3 .elementor-heading-title{font-size:var( --e-global-typography-a20d4d8-font-size );line-height:var( --e-global-typography-a20d4d8-line-height );}.elementor-3039 .elementor-element.elementor-element-656296c .elementor-heading-title{font-size:var( --e-global-typography-408b3ee-font-size );letter-spacing:var( --e-global-typography-408b3ee-letter-spacing );}.elementor-3039 .elementor-element.elementor-element-341b7a1 .elementor-heading-title{font-size:var( --e-global-typography-408b3ee-font-size );letter-spacing:var( --e-global-typography-408b3ee-letter-spacing );}}@media(max-width:1024px){.elementor-3039 .elementor-element.elementor-element-32abc935{--padding-top:16%;--padding-bottom:16%;--padding-left:8%;--padding-right:8%;}.elementor-3039 .elementor-element.elementor-element-1ffa42ab{--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--gap:1em 1em;--row-gap:1em;--column-gap:1em;}.elementor-3039 .elementor-element.elementor-element-fd429f3 .elementor-heading-title{font-size:var( --e-global-typography-a20d4d8-font-size );line-height:var( --e-global-typography-a20d4d8-line-height );}.elementor-3039 .elementor-element.elementor-element-7e58dc19{--gap:4% 4%;--row-gap:4%;--column-gap:4%;}.elementor-3039 .elementor-element.elementor-element-656296c .elementor-heading-title{font-size:var( --e-global-typography-408b3ee-font-size );letter-spacing:var( --e-global-typography-408b3ee-letter-spacing );}.elementor-3039 .elementor-element.elementor-element-341b7a1 .elementor-heading-title{font-size:var( --e-global-typography-408b3ee-font-size );letter-spacing:var( --e-global-typography-408b3ee-letter-spacing );}}@media(max-width:767px){.elementor-3039 .elementor-element.elementor-element-32abc935{--padding-top:20%;--padding-bottom:20%;--padding-left:8%;--padding-right:8%;}.elementor-3039 .elementor-element.elementor-element-fd429f3{text-align:center;}.elementor-3039 .elementor-element.elementor-element-fd429f3 .elementor-heading-title{font-size:var( --e-global-typography-a20d4d8-font-size );line-height:var( --e-global-typography-a20d4d8-line-height );}.elementor-3039 .elementor-element.elementor-element-7e58dc19{--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:1em 1em;--row-gap:1em;--column-gap:1em;--flex-wrap:nowrap;}.elementor-3039 .elementor-element.elementor-element-656296c .elementor-heading-title{font-size:var( --e-global-typography-408b3ee-font-size );letter-spacing:var( --e-global-typography-408b3ee-letter-spacing );}.elementor-3039 .elementor-element.elementor-element-341b7a1 .elementor-heading-title{font-size:var( --e-global-typography-408b3ee-font-size );letter-spacing:var( --e-global-typography-408b3ee-letter-spacing );}}@media(min-width:768px){.elementor-3039 .elementor-element.elementor-element-32abc935{--content-width:800px;}}/* Start custom CSS for theme-post-content, class: .elementor-element-7b103e9 */.elementor-3039 .elementor-element.elementor-element-7b103e9 {
    padding-top: 0 !important;
}
.elementor-3039 .elementor-element.elementor-element-7b103e9 h3 {
    margin-top: 1.5em;
}
.elementor-3039 .elementor-element.elementor-element-7b103e9 h3:last-of-type {
    margin-top: 0.5em;
}/* End custom CSS */